  • Exploring Tree Canopies with Nalini Nadkarni

    31/01/2023 Durata: 31min

    Nalini Nadkarni is an ecologist who helped revolutionize the study of forest canopies. In 1980, Nalini started using mountain climbing techniques to ascend to the treetops in the Costa Rican rainforest. When Nalini isn't traversing tree canopies, she's advocating for environmental conservation and education.   • Motorcycles and Mindfulness with Monica Ramos

    15/11/2022 Durata: 30min

    In 2021, yoga instructor Monica Ramos packed up her home and went on a motorcycle adventure with her husband and their eight-year-old daughter. The family of three left their home in Costa Rica and rode for four months: one month to get to Mexico and more than two months exploring every corner of the country.
